我在wp-admin/post.php页面上得到一个Javascript错误,它阻止我添加标签/编辑帖子的链接。几乎所有关于JS的事..。无论如何,错误是:
> Error: d.delegate is not a function
> Source File:
> http://www.mysite.com/wp-admin/load-scripts.php?c=1&load=hoverIntent,common,jquery-color,schedule,wp-ajax-response,autosave,wp-lists,jquery-ui-core,jquery-ui-widget,jquery-ui-mouse,jquery-ui-resizable,jquery-query,admin-comments,suggest,jquery-ui-sortable,postbox,post,word-count,thickbox,media-upload&ver=c1c854f5d9062306d43d7331055686c9
> Line: 42更新
唯一可行的解决方案是将Wordpress网站的评级下调至3.0.5
我不知道为什么会这样,但经过5个小时的调试-我不在乎
发布于 2011-04-11 15:17:10
我建议禁用脚本连接和/或压缩,看看这是否有帮助。您可以通过在wp-config.php文件中添加以下内容来做到这一点:
define( 'CONCATENATE_SCRIPTS', false );
define( 'COMPRESS_SCRIPTS', false );甚至把调试脚本..。
define( 'SCRIPT_DEBUG', true );您是否使用缓存插件?
编辑:
看到这个消息的最常见的原因似乎是运行一个旧版本的jQuery,即。任何低于1.4.2的。您有加载jQuery的插件吗?
发布于 2011-04-11 15:14:46
javascript在后端的任何地方工作吗?也就是说,javascript在您的仪表板上工作吗?在编辑屏幕上为其他的帖子类型(例如页面)?
如果javascript在后端的任何地方都不能工作,请在数据库配置之后将以下内容添加到wp-config.php中:
define('CONCATENATE_SCRIPTS', false);这似乎解决了后端的一些烦人的javascript问题,特别是当您与其他脚本最小化功能发生冲突时(例如,通过缓存插件或代理/CDN服务)。
发布于 2011-03-14 18:32:35
如果您已经验证了在禁用所有插件并切换回默认/包含主题之后仍然会发生错误,那么您可以尝试重新安装WordPress。有时,在下载更新过程中,单个文件(或两个文件)可能会损坏。
要重新安装WordPress,请登录到WordPress站点的管理部分,然后转到更新页面(http://yourblogurl/wp-admin/update-core.php)。在那里,你应该看到一个按钮标签为“重新安装自动”。这将重新下载WordPress文件,覆盖以前可能已损坏的任何内容。
https://wordpress.stackexchange.com/questions/11398
复制相似问题